Understanding the Power of a Foxwell OBD2 EOBD Code Reader

Foxwell is a respected name in the automotive diagnostic industry, known for creating reliable and feature-rich code readers. But what exactly does a Foxwell OBD2 EOBD code reader do? These handy devices plug into your vehicle’s OBD2 port (usually located under the dashboard) and communicate with the onboard computer. This allows you to read and clear di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s), which are essentially error messages generated by your car’s systems.

By understanding these codes, you can pinpoint the source of a problem, from a faulty oxygen sensor to a misfiring cylinder. This knowledge empowers you to make informed decisions about repairs, avoiding unnecessary guesswork and potentially expensive replacements. Some advanced Foxwell scanners even offer live data streaming, allowing you to monitor various sensor readings in real-time. This is particularly useful for diagnosing intermittent issues or tracking the performance of specific components.

How to Use a Foxwell OBD2 EOBD Code Reader

Using a Foxwell OBD2 EOBD code reader is generally straightforward. Locate your vehicle’s OBD2 port, usually under the dashboard on the driver’s side. Plug the code reader into the port and turn the ignition on (without starting the engine). The code reader will then power on and begin communicating with your car’s computer. Follow the on-screen prompts to read or clear codes. Most Foxwell scanners have intuitive menus and user-friendly interfaces.

Foxwell NT301 Plus: A Comprehensive Look

The Foxwell NT301 Plus is a popular choice for both DIYers and professionals, offering a balance of affordability and functionality. It reads and clears a wide range of codes, including generic and manufacturer-specific codes. It also offers features such as data logging and freeze frame data retrieval, providing a deeper understanding of the fault conditions.
